The Fugees announced to their fans that the group would be reuniting for a tour to celebrate the 25th anniversary of their album The Score. They held their first show in 15 years in New York City last week. While they left fans waiting for quite some time, they appeared to have been worth the wait.

The Haitian American band was known for putting on a show in the states, but bandmates Lauryn Hill and Wyclef Jean also brought fans out in Haiti.

Pras Michel, another member of the legendary group, also had a successful stint as a solo artist. We surely hope his classic joint "Ghetto Superstar (That Is What You Are)," featuring Mýa, makes the approved tracklist for their anniversary tour. 

Among some of the notable fans is Whoopi Goldberg, who posed with The Fugees at the MTV Movie Awards in 1996.

Hill and Jean also flicked it up at the MTV Europe Music Awards with musician Mick Hucknall.

After the group broke up, Hill went on to have a successful solo career, too. With her hits "Ex-Factor," "Doo Wop (That Thing)," "Can't Take My Eyes Off of You" and "Nothing Even Matters" the singer cemented herself as an R&B and neo-soul icon.
